MEP Design and Consulting Services

The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ing (MEP) Team specializes in designing high-performance building, lighting, and power systems for commercial, industrial and residential applications, and for municipal assets such as lift stations and wastewater treatment plants. Our project approach emphasizes sustainability and practicality, eliminating oversized and overly complicated “solutions.” The Western Slope presents many unique and challenging environments for MEP projects–our local expertise sets the bar for project success.

Commissioning Projects

The Ritz Carlton Full facility Audit and Recommissioning of HVAC and Control Systems and EDM,preliminary year one savings of over $80,000
Grand River Health Proof of Performance Commissioning of HVAC, Lighting and Control Systems of new Battlement Mesa facility
Aspen School District Recommissioning of HVAC and Control Systems and EDM, saved over $5,000 during Spring Break week
Grand River Health Monitoring Based Commissioning of HVAC, Lighting and Control Systems of existing Rifle facility
Riverside Professional Building Full facility Audit and Retrocommissioning of HVAC and Control Systems, reduced energy use by 60% with a 5-year simple payback
Shea Garfield County Office Building Proof of Performance Commissioning of HVAC, Lighting and Control Systems
St. Regis Aspen Proof of Performance Commissioning of retrofitted HVAC system
Dancing Bear Aspen Recommissioning of HVAC and Control Systems and EDM
Town of Parachute Retrocommissioning of HVAC and Control Systems, reduced annual $/sf by 25%
City of Glenwood Springs Retrocommissioning and LEED consulting of newly constructed Wastewater Treatment Facility and Lift Station
City of Aspen Part of Burlingame Phase II commissioning team, providing envelope testing for 48 units with high performance goals

Alternative Energy Projects
Roaring Fork Transportation Authority Project Manager for nationally recognized$5.3M CNG facilities project including due diligence, design, construction oversight and ongoing safety inspections for fueling station and maintenance facility upgrades
Steamboat Springs Transit Alternative Fuel Analysis and energy price forecasting for diesel, hybrid, natural gas and battery-electric buses
Town of New Castle Project Manager for 70 kW photovoltaic Power Purchase Agreement project including due diligence, draft RFP, and manage solicitation process
Knapp Ranch Conceptual energy balance analysis to identify viable off-grid opportunities including hydro, solar and biomass; used state of the art energy monitoring network; evaluated 7 micro hydro sites
Colorado Energy Office Developed a financial model & feasibility report template for the State; research and develop small hydro case studies
Welles-Barr Residence Energy balance analysis to identify viable off-grid opportunities for heat and power including solar and biomass
City of Glenwood Springs Designed geothermal snowmelt system for pedestrian bridge using waste heat from Hot Springs Pool
